1999 Chevrolet Astro Van 2WD V6-4.3L VIN WSECTION Control Assembly Replacement
Control Assembly Replacement


REMOVAL PROCEDURE




1. Remove the instrument cluster trim plate.
2. Remove the retaining screw from the left edge of the control assembly.
3. Pivot the control assembly from the instrument panel.
4. Pull the control assembly out of the instrument panel in order to access the vacuum and the electrical connectors.

Heater Control Vacuum And Electrical Harness:




5. Disconnect the following items from the control assembly:
^ The electrical connectors.
^ The vacuum connectors.

INSTALLATION PROCEDURE

Heater Control Vacuum And Electrical Harness:




1. Connect the following items to the control assembly:
^ The vacuum connectors.
^ The electrical connectors.




2. Align the tab on the control assembly with the slot in the instrument panel.
3. Pivot the control assembly into the instrument panel.

NOTE: Refer to Fastener Notice in Service Precautions.

4. Install the screw in order to retain the left edge of the control assembly.

Tighten
Tighten the screw in order to retain the left edge of the control assembly to 2 N.m (18 lb in).

5. Install the instrument cluster trim plate.
